Publisher's Synopsis

Sustainable tourism development is a concept that is involved in the management of all resources in such a manner that the economic, social and aesthetic needs of tourists are fulfilled while maintaining the cultural integrity, essential ecological processes, biological diversity, and life support systems of a tourist place. This approach can be used as an efficient strategy for increasing economic growth, alleviating poverty, creating jobs and improving food security. There are four basic principles which are fundamental to the concept of sustainable development. These include holistic planning and strategy making; preserving essential ecological processes; protecting both human heritage and biodiversity; and ensuring sustainable production to ensure that productivity can be sustained over the long-term for the future generations.
